Abstract

Energy consumption and carbon dioxide emissions are a problem in the metallurgical industries. The synthesis of manganese and silicomanganese using concentrated solar energy is proposed in this paper. Mixtures of oxide of manganese (IV) and silicon (50 wt% and 75 wt%) were treated in a 1.5 kW solar furnace located in Odeillo. Results demonstrated that mixtures of manganese and silicon, but also silicomanganese, are obtained after treatment even in the less favorable situation: without iron, which reduces the liquidus temperature, and without slag-forming reagents.
